WebTo calculate calorie burn using METs, use this formula: HTML. MET value x 3.5 x (weight in kg) ÷ 200 = calories burned per minute. WebOne MET is the energy expended at rest, two METs indicates the energy expended is twice that at rest, three METs is triple the resting energy expenditure, etc. Remember that …
